Ex-Otley mayor's team is top of the pop quizzes

A FORMER Otley mayor has once again proven his prowess at pop trivia by winning a major competition.

Jonathan Kirkland (above) was part of a four-strong team, the Northern Lights, which took part in the West Midlands Pop Quiz Championship in Staffordshire - and came out triumphant.

The quiz is regarded as one of the toughest in the country and the group was up against some formidable opposition in the form of music business insiders and critics.

Mr Kirkland, 45, said: "This is one of the top pop quizzes and the questions span from the 1950s to the present day and cover all the musical genres, so you've got to have a pretty encyclopaedic knowledge of pop music.

"You're up against quality opposition, the people on other teams were from inside the industry and had written books on pop music, so it is quite an honour to win it - we got a trophy and a cash prize.

"The questions started at lunchtime and ran through until last orders, so it was quite a challenge.

"I've been doing quizzes for the last 12 years and it's one of my big hobbies. But I do want to emphasise that we all do actually have lives - we don't just sit in swotting pop quiz questions all the time!"

The team has had its current line-up for four years, takes part in a monthly quiz in Wakefield and is currently joint top of its local pop quiz league.

They last won the competition in 2005 when they were called The Mayor and The Simpletons in honour of Mr Kirkland's year in office, from 2004 to 2005.

Mr Kirkland will be putting his pop quiz knowledge to good use again in a few weeks' time when he and a team from the civil service in Leeds - where he works - will be attempting to defend another championship.
